What does this automation do?
Form feedback is categorized, then sent down one of three paths — unhappy gets an agent and an owner, mixed gets a task, delighted gets shared with the team.

The Steps
This automation runs in 3 steps:
- When Typeform — New Submission
- Then Taskade AI — Categorize with AI
- Then Branch — Unhappy: Ask Agent, Add Task, Assign Task · Mixed or neutral: Add Task · Delighted: Send Channel Message
What makes this different from a Zapier-style flow?
The "Retention Desk" step is not a one-off model call. It is a Taskade AI agent that knows your refund policy, plans and past save offers, remembers which customers it has already reached out to, so every run builds on the last one instead of starting from an empty prompt.
A stateless "ask the model" step forgets everything the moment it returns. An agent keeps its knowledge and its memory between runs, carries its own tools, and can be handed work by other automations.

How do you set it up?
- Open the "Automations" tab in your workspace.
- Click ➕ Add automation, then start from scratch.
- Add the trigger "New Submission" from Typeform.
- Add the action "Categorize with AI" from Taskade AI.
- Add a Branch step: Branch — Unhappy: Ask Agent, Add Task, Assign Task · Mixed or neutral: Add Task · Delighted: Send Channel Message.
- Enable the toggle in the top-right corner to activate the automation.
